设置
产品简介
用户可以在小程序设置页里控制授权状态,设置页位置:右上角-更多-关于-更多-设置
开放标准
对所有入驻小程序的企业开放
接口说明
jd.openSetting(OBJECT)
调起宿主客户端小程序设置界面,返回用户设置的操作结果,设置界面只会出现小程序已经向用户请求过的权限。
Object 参数说明:
参数 | 类型 | 必填 | 说明 |
---|---|---|---|
success | Function | 否 | 接口调用成功的回调函数,返回内容详见返回参数说明 |
fail | Function | 否 | 接口调用失败的回调函数 |
complete | Function | 否 | 接口调用结束的回调函数(调用成功、失败都会执行) |
success 返回参数说明:
参数 | 类型 | 说明 |
---|---|---|
authSetting | Object | 用户授权结果,其中 key 为 scope 值,value 为 Bool 值,表示用户是否允许授权 |
示例代码:
jd.openSetting({
success: (res) => {
console.log(res)
}
})
jd.getSetting(OBJECT)
获取用户当前设置,返回值中只会出现小程序向用户请求过的权限
Object 参数说明:
参数 | 类型 | 必填 | 说明 |
---|---|---|---|
success | Function | 否 | 接口调用成功的回调函数,返回内容详见返回参数说明 |
fail | Function | 否 | 接口调用失败的回调函数 |
complete | Function | 否 | 接口调用结束的回调函数(调用成功、失败都会执行) |
success 返回参数说明:
参数 | 类型 | 说明 |
---|---|---|
authSetting | Object | 用户授权结果,其中 key 为 scope 值,value 为 Bool 值,表示用户是否允许授权 |
示例代码:
jd.getSetting({
success: (res) => {
console.log(res);
}
})
注意 这两个API在IDE上暂时无法使用,请使用真机测试。